Don&#8217;t be deceived by the title, this book is not just about making your organization lean. It&#8217;s about how to engage the people in the organization in the process to help you be more successful.</p>
<p><span id="more-592"></span></p>
<p><img src="http://www.askteamdoc.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/gottabelean.jpg" alt="" title="gottabelean" width="107" height="160" class="alignright size-medium wp-image-598" />Hajek says the main goals of the book are to 1) increase the collaboration between overwhelmed employees and overburdened managers and 2) help the frontline workforce find job satisfaction in highly productive, fast-paced, rapidly changing workplaces. And he&#8217;s hit the target. This book will help you achieve both of those goals &#8230; and more.</p>
<p>Written in very practical, actionable language, Hajek walks you through the steps necessary to get your organization where you want it to go. But my favorite part is Chapters 8 through 11. These four chapters can be your handbook for dealing with the people side of the change equation &#8212; the most important part in my opinion. These chapters are written in a problem / solution format, and answer key questions:</p>
<ul>
<li>How this affects you</li>
<li>Action to take</li>
<li>Why this works</li>
</ul>
<p>If your organization is struggling through making improvements &#8212; lean or not &#8212; this book will help your journey be a successful one.
